Press Release Body = July 26, 2007- (www.smilesouthflorida.com) MIAMI, BOCA RATON AND FORT LAUDERDALE, FLORIDA The effects of a missing tooth can run far deeper than a flawed smile.

People with missing teeth often feel self-conscious about their smiles. They can have difficulty eating certain foods. Missing teeth can even change a person's bite pattern.

Dr. Richard Morrow, a periodontist at Smile South Florida Cosmetic Dentistry in Boca Raton and Broward County is an expert in restoring confidence, self-esteem and dental health in patients with the use of dental implants.

Dental implants are artificial teeth that look and feel like the real thing. They are placed into the jaw to hold a replacement tooth or bridge.

Dental implants are an ideal choice for patients who are missing teeth due to an injury, disease or decay,- said Dr. Charles Nottingham, a cosmetic dentist who is the senior partner of Smile South Florida Cosmetic Dentistry.

If a patient is healthy and the bone is healthy enough to receive dental implants, 'that is the state-of-the-art way to go,- Nottingham said. 'It is the most recommended treatment at this point.-

If placed properly by a periodontist and properly maintained by the patient, dental implants can last a lifetime.

That is important because as life spans increase, a permanent dental replacement is increasingly desirable. Dentures and bridges can be loose and unstable, while dental implants are natural looking, functional and permanent. They look and feel better than traditional removable bridges, and offer the same force for biting as bridges that are fixed in place, according to www.aboutcosmeticdentistry.com.

Choosing a periodontist
It is important that patients do their homework when seeking the right periodontist to install dental implants, Nottingham said. Because this is a surgical procedure, finding a well-credentialed periodontist with a good track record should be paramount.

Although many cosmetic procedures are performed by family dentists, periodontists have the education and training that give them an artistic advantage to achieving natural-looking results for their patients.

Selecting a periodontist who is a member of the American Academy of Periodontology is a great start to achieving good results from dental implants.
